Output e7420cb51f939fa203a574c284399328da74837d290defc187d83709f010e5f7:4
- value
- 18599971
- script pubkey
- OP_0 OP_PUSHBYTES_20 37b05350406d4f019126f0a955de5fc09fa88f10
- address
- bc1qx7c9x5zqd48sryfx7z54thjlcz063rcssqme7n
- transaction
- e7420cb51f939fa203a574c284399328da74837d290defc187d83709f010e5f7
- confirmations
- 309397
- spent
- true